The module provides an overview of the origin and internal structure of the Earth, plate tectonics, and the formation, classification and applied significance of minerals, igneous, metamorphic and sedimentary rocks and geological structures.
- overview of module, Earth structure and plate tectonics, internal structure of Earth, introduction to minerals/rock groups and stratigraphy;
- continental drift, sea-floor spreading and plate tectonics;
- sedimentology and surface processes: the description and classification of sedimentary rocks, physical properties of fluid flows resulting in sediment transport and deposition, major depositional environments, introduction to palaeontology and further examples of stratigraphy;
- igneous and metamorphic petrology: igneous activity at the present day, classification of igneous rocks, major processes responsible for common igneous phenomena, contact and regional metamorphism, processes and products;
- structural geology: the nature, classification and applied significance of structures formed during deformation of the lithosphere, controls on the rheology of geological materials, outcrop patterns of simple structures on geological maps.
